Output 98408e456dfa275e19b22033a0344304bbd04b16aecbdaffdef667bee52d9aa9:0

value
520694317
script pubkey
OP_0 OP_PUSHBYTES_20 33bc4428fcad57c702c5a667dab745a891b8f6da
address
bc1qxw7yg28u44tuwqk95ena4d694zgm3ak6evkkxx
transaction
98408e456dfa275e19b22033a0344304bbd04b16aecbdaffdef667bee52d9aa9